Understanding‍ the Importance of‌ Exhaust‌ Flow

Defining Exhaust Flow

Exhaust‌ flow‌ refers‌ to‍ the‌ smooth‍ and efficient‍ movement‌ of exhaust gases‌ from the‍ engine’s‍ cylinders‌ to‍ the‌ atmosphere. A restricted exhaust flow‌ can‌ impede the‌ engine’s ability‌ to expel spent‌ gases, leading‌ to‌ reduced‌ performance‍ and potentially causing damage. This restriction can‍ stem from‌ various issues, including a factory-designed exhaust system‌ that isn’t optimized‍ for maximum‌ performance, or‍ a‍ damaged‍ exhaust‌ system. Headers, the‌ components‍ linking the‌ engine’s‌ exhaust ports to the‍ main exhaust system, play‍ a vital role in‌ managing‍ this‍ flow.

The Role of‍ Exhaust‌ Headers in‌ Vehicle‌ Performance‌

Proper‍ exhaust flow directly impacts a vehicle’s‍ overall‌ performance. Headers, acting‌ as‌ a bridge between the engine‍ and the exhaust system, impact‌ a vehicle’s performance in‌ several‌ ways. Adequate‌ flow enhances engine output, leading‌ to increased horsepower‍ and‍ torque. This‌ improved engine‍ output results‍ in‍ noticeable benefits like‍ quicker acceleration‌ and a more responsive driving experience.

Improving Exhaust Flow Through Header‍ Upgrades‍

Upgrading your headers‌ is often‌ a‌ decisive‌ step‌ toward‌ optimizing exhaust flow. By replacing‍ restrictive factory‌ headers‍ with‍ upgraded‌ high-performance ones, drivers experience improved exhaust‍ velocity, reducing‌ exhaust back‍ pressure, which‌ greatly benefits‍ the‍ engine’s combustion‌ process. By‌ facilitating quicker‌ exhaust‍ gas‌ evacuation, it can‌ lead to considerable‌ gains in‍ horsepower‌ and torque.

Installation and‌ Tuning Considerations‌

Importance of Proper‌ Installation

Installing‍ headers correctly‌ is‌ crucial‌ to ensuring‌ optimal performance‌ and‍ avoiding potential‍ issues. Incorrect‍ installation can‍ result in‌ leaks or‍ restricted exhaust‌ flow, hindering‌ performance‍ gains‍ and potentially causing damage to‍ your engine. Proper‌ installation‍ requires‌ specialized‌ tools‌ and‍ expertise. A professional‍ mechanic‍ should handle this‌ task, especially for more‌ complex installations.

Engine Tuning for‌ Maximum Effectiveness

Upgrading‌ your‌ headers often‌ necessitates additional‍ optimization, such as‌ engine tuning. Header‍ upgrades‍ typically‍ need matching‍ engine calibrations or‍ adjustments to fully capitalize‌ on‌ the improved exhaust‌ flow. Tuning‍ can help to optimize‌ engine efficiency‌ and‍ maximize performance‍ benefits. If you’re‍ not familiar with‌ engine‌ tuning, it’s‍ best to‌ consult a‍ professional‌ mechanic‍ or tuner.

Frequently‌ Asked‍ Questions‍

What‍ are‌ the main‌ benefits of upgrading‌ exhaust headers?

Upgrading exhaust‍ headers can significantly improve engine performance by facilitating better‌ exhaust‌ gas‍ flow. This‌ leads to increased horsepower and torque‍ output, resulting‍ in‍ a noticeable‍ improvement in acceleration‍ and overall responsiveness. Also, optimized exhaust flow‍ contributes to better fuel economy‍ and a‌ smoother‌ engine operation.

How much will upgrading exhaust‍ headers cost?

The‍ cost‍ of upgrading‍ exhaust‍ headers‌ varies greatly depending‌ on‌ the‌ make, model, and year of your vehicle. Prices also‌ fluctuate‌ based‍ on the material‍ (stainless steel‍ is‌ more‍ costly) and the‍ brand of headers. Some‌ high-performance headers can cost several‌ hundred‍ dollars. For a‍ reasonable upgrade‌ with good performance value, expect to spend a‍ few hundred dollars. However, remember to‍ factor‌ in‍ installation costs‌ and any‌ additional parts needed.

Are there any‌ risks associated with‍ upgrading exhaust‍ headers?

While upgrading exhaust‌ headers typically results‍ in significant gains, some potential risks must‍ be‍ considered. Improper installation‌ or‌ inadequate‌ exhaust system design‌ can affect overall‍ engine‍ efficiency and potentially void‍ vehicle warranty‍ protections. Also, consider‌ that louder‌ exhaust systems‌ may not‌ comply‍ with local noise regulations.
